Doncaster Fencing Club Awarded a Sport England Return to Play Grant.


Doncaster Fencing Club has been awarded a grant by Sport England, from their Return to Play fund.
The Return to Play: Small Grants fund seeks to support projects addressing the challenges coronavirus (Covid-19) has posed to people taking part in sport and physical activity.
The fund will support activity under 4 main headings:
⦁ Minor facility alternations (such as changes required to adhere to published government guidance).
⦁ Service alterations (such as coronavirus-related adaptations, repairs and modifications, e.g. safety screening and contactless payment systems or volunteer training, e.g. health and safety requirements, risk assessments, etc.)
⦁ Operational alterations (such as signage/floor markings – maintaining social distance and avoiding congestion; cleaning/hygiene – keeping facilities and equipment clean; additional sports equipment/kit – minimising sharing.)
⦁ Running costs (considered from organisations delivering their activities in the most deprived communities – those located in areas of high deprivation (decile 1-3 of the Indices of Deprivation).
Doncaster Fencing Club made an application and were successful. As a small club this will make the world of difference to us.
